The University of Arizona: The Wasserstein geometry of random measures through superposition principles
In this talk, I will introduce the space of random measures $\mathcal{P}_p(\mathcal{P}_p(X))$, endowed with the Wasserstein-on-Wasserstein metric, where $(X, d)$ is a complete separable metric space.
